Care and Cleaning Instructions
- Hand Wash Only: To preserve the delicate copper finish on the handle, hand-washing with a mild liquid soap and a soft sponge is highly recommended. [1, 2]
- Prevent Tarnish: Avoid using abrasive metal scrubbing pads on the handle. If the copper color begins to naturally oxidize or dull over time, a quick wipe with lemon juice or a gentle copper polish will instantly restore its luster. [1, 2, 3]
